Early Warning Signs Include: Fatigue or low energy Frequent colds or infections Slow wound healing Dry, rough, or inflamed skin Easy bruising Joint discomfort Gum irritation or bleeding Severe Deficiency (Scurvy) Can Cause: Intense fatigue Swollen or bleeding gums Weak collagen formation Hair thinning or weakening Worsening anemia Significant immune dysfunction While severe deficiency is rare today, mild to moderate low vitamin C levels are extremely common, especially in individuals with chronic stress, poor diet, smoking habits, autoimmune conditions, or digestive issues
